Khuri Chhoti Population - Sikar, Rajasthan

Khuri Chhoti is a medium size village located in Lachhmangarh Tehsil of Sikar district, Rajasthan with total 295 families residing. The Khuri Chhoti village has population of 1767 of which 906 are males while 861 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Khuri Chhoti village population of children with age 0-6 is 221 which makes up 12.51 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Khuri Chhoti village is 950 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Khuri Chhoti as per census is 811,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

Khuri Chhoti village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Khuri Chhoti village was 73.09 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Khuri Chhoti Male literacy stands at 88.01 % while female literacy rate was 57.74 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 19.02 % of total population in Khuri Chhoti village. The village Khuri Chhoti curr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Khuri Chhoti village out of total population, 770 were engaged in work activities. 94.16 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 5.84 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 770 workers engaged in Main Work, 617 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 25 were Agricultural labourer.
